From 06059e134de6817418335516f56bbf4280ff351b Mon Sep 17 00:00:00 2001 From: zjh <1084500556@qq.com> Date: 星期六, 04 一月 2025 18:56:07 +0800 Subject: [PATCH] zjh20250104 --- 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jFlowingWaterController.java | 12 +++++++++++- 1 files changed, 11 insertions(+), 1 deletions(-) diff --git a/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jFlowingWaterController.java b/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jFlowingWaterController.java index f79df97..b1698ec 100644 --- a/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jFlowingWaterController.java +++ b/ltkj-admin/src/main/java/com/ltkj/web/controller/system/TjFlowingWaterController.java @@ -92,6 +92,8 @@ private TjFlowingWaterHisService tjFlowingWaterHisService; @Autowired private ITjSamplingService tjSamplingService; + @Autowired + private TjOrderController tjOrderController; /** * 鏌ヨ璇ヤ綋妫�鍙峰搴旂殑璁㈠崟娴佹按鍒楄〃 @@ -437,10 +439,18 @@ if (null != tbTransitionList && !tbTransitionList.isEmpty()) { // extracted(order, list2, tbTransitionList); //寮傛娣诲姞鏀惰垂鏄庣粏 - asyncService.collectFees(order, list2, tbTransitionList, sysUser, tjFlowingWater.getDiscount()); +// asyncService.collectFees(order, list2, tbTransitionList, sysUser, tjFlowingWater.getDiscount()); Map<String, Object> map = new HashMap<>(); map.put("waterId", tjFlowingWater.getWaterId()); map.put("mobanId", reportService.getMoBanIds()); + + SysUser user = null; + if (flowingWater.getCreateId()!= null) + user = userService.getById(flowingWater.getCreateId()); + else user = userService.getById(1L); + TjOrder tjOrder = orderService.getById(flowingWater.getOrderId()); + List<TjOrderDetail> detailList1 = detailService.getCaiYangDengJi(flowingWater.getOrderId()); + tjOrderController.addCaiYangDengJi(detailList1, !detailList1.isEmpty(), tjOrder, user, null); return AjaxResult.success("鏀惰垂鎴愬姛", map); } } -- Gitblit v1.8.0